Overview of Julian Jaynes's Theory
In January of 1977 Princeton University psychologist Julian Jaynes (1920–1997) put forth a bold new theory of the origin of consciousness and a previous mentality known as the bicameral mind in the controversial but critically acclaimed book The Origin of Consciousness in the Breakdown of the Bicameral Mind. Jaynes was far ahead of his time, and his theory remains as relevant today as when it was first published.

Jaynes asserts that consciousness did not arise far back in human evolution but is a learned process based on metaphorical language. Prior to the development of consciousness, Jaynes argues humans operated under a previous mentality he called the bicameral ('two-chambered') mind. In the place of an internal dialogue, bicameral people experienced auditory hallucinations directing their actions, similar to the command hallucinations experienced by many people who hear voices today. These hallucinations were interpreted as the voices of chiefs, rulers, or the gods.

To support his theory, Jaynes draws evidence from a wide range of fields, including neuroscience, psychology, archeology, ancient history, and the analysis of ancient texts. Jaynes's theory has profound implications for human history as well as a variety of aspects of modern society such as mental health, religious belief, susceptibility to persuasion, psychological anomalies such as hypnosis and possession, and our ongoing conscious evolution.

Now, I take Jaynes to be making a similarly exciting and striking move with regard to consciousness. To put it really somewhat paradoxically  you can’t have consciousness until you have the concept of consciousness. In fact he has a more subtle theory than that, but that’s the basic shape of the move.

These aren’t the only two phenomena, morality and consciousness, that work this way. Another one that Jaynes mentions is history, and at first one thinks. “Here’s another use-mention error!” At one point in the book Jaynes suggests that history was invented or discovered just a few years before Herodotus, and one starts to object that of course there was history long before there were historians, but then one realizes that in a sense Jaynes is right. Is there a history of lions and antelopes? Just as many years have passed for them as for us, and things have happened to them, but it is very different. Their passage of time has not been conditioned by their recognition of the transition, it has not been conditioned and tuned and modulated by any reflective consideration of that very process. So history itself, our having histories, is in part a function of our recognizing that very fact. Other phenomena in this category are obvious: you can’t have baseball before you have the concept of baseball, you can t have money before you have the concept of money.

I have used up as much time as I should use, but I am going to say a few more words. If you want to pursue the interesting idea that consciousness postdates the arrival of a certain set of concepts, then of course you have to have in your conceptual armamentarium the idea that concepts themselves can be preconscious, that concepts do not require consciousness. Many have
held that there is no such thing as the unconscious wielding of concepts, but Jaynes’ account of the origins of consciousness depends on the claim that an elaboration of a conceptual scheme under certain social and environmental pressures was the precondition for the emergence of consciousness as we know it. This is, to my mind, the most important claim that Jaynes makes in his book. As he puts it, “The bee has a concept of the flower,” but not a conscious concept. We
have a very salient theoretical role for something which we might as well call concepts, but if you
don’t like it we can call them schmoncepts, concept-like things that you don’t have to be conscious to have.

For instance, computers have them. They are not conscious—yet—but they have lots of concepts,...

The underlying hardware of the brain is just the same now as it was thousands of years ago (or it may be just the same), but what had to happen was that the environment had to be such as to encourage the development, the emergence, of certain concepts, certain software, which then set in motion some sort of chain reaction. Jaynes is saying that when the right concepts settled into place in the preconscious minds” of our ancestors, there was a sort of explosion. like the explosion in computer science that happens when you invent something like LISP. Suddenly you discover a new logical space. where you get the sorts of different behaviors, the sorts of new powers, the sorts of new problems that we recognize as having the flavor of human consciousness.

Of course, if that is what Jaynes’ theory really is, it is no wonder he has to be bold in his interpretation of the tangible evidence, because this isn't just archaeology he is doing: this is software archaeology, and software doesn't leave much of a fossil record. Software, after all, is just concepts. It is abstract and yet, of course, once it is embodied it has very real effects. So if you want to find a record of major “software” changes in archaeological history, what are you going to have to look at? You are going to have to look at the “printouts,” but they are very indirect. You are going to have to look at texts, and you are going to have to look at the pottery shards and figurines as Jaynes does, because that is the only of course, maybe the traces are just gone, maybe the “fossil record” is simply not good enough. Jaynes’ idea is that for us to be the way we are now, there has to have been a revolution— almost certainly not an organic revolution, but a software revolution—in the organization of our information processing system, and that has to have come after language. That, I think, is an absolutely wonderful idea, and if Jaynes is completely wrong in the details, that is a darn shame,
but something like what he proposes has to be right; and we can start looking around for better modules to put in the place of the modules that he has already given us.

I have clipped what I consider to be some interesting parts of a very powerful article on the nature of thought:

In this paper, it will be argued that semiotic cognition can be conceived as a distinctive form of cognition, which evolved out of earlier forms of non-semiotic cognition. Semiotic cognition depends on the use of signs and it will be shown that a sign is not a ‘thing’, but rather the name given to a specific organization, or structure, of the cognitive process. Once semiotic cognition was available to humans, its structure may have provided the ground for an evolutionary development that was no longer strictly Darwinian, but followed its own semiotic logic. Semiotic cognition confronts humans with a difference that cannot be eliminated, and it is in the ways in which this difference is dealt with that we may discover a logic of cultural evolution that determines the course of long term cultural change. (p116)

If we want to explain this absence of meaning and with it the emergence of a specifically human sense of reality, of time, space, and self, we have to assume that human cognition is based upon a very peculiar system of representation (or ‘pattern matching’) which allows us to process what is seen and heard at the same time, both in terms of stable patterns and of global, concrete and necessarily ‘fuzzy’ patterns. This double processing generates a difference between the stable pattern, which corresponds to what we have called memory, on the one hand, and an instable, always changing pattern corresponding to what one could name the ‘here and now’ or the ‘present’, on the other hand. In a conscious human mind the two patterns never merge completely. (p122)

[Difference] may have freed humans from immediacy, from the continuous ‘now’ in which most, if not all, other organisms live and it probably enabled us to deal with our environment independently of what is simply ‘the case’ in fantasy, myths, religion, technology, the arts and sciences, philosophy. These worlds that we construct in our imagination allow us to cope with change in a more sophisticated way than other organisms do. It does not take long to figure out the profit. What distinguishes human cognition and culture from that of other organisms is not meaning, but the absence of meaning. (p123)

If the assumption put forward here is correct we may investigate further in two directions. ‘Backward’, in order to try to find out and explain how such a double processing could have come about in the evolution of hominids, which is the subject of evolutionary psychology. And ‘forward,’ to find out if and how the peculiar structure of human cognition may have influenced the evolution of human culture. Let us first try to go ‘backward’, finding out about the possible evolutionary development of the human capacity for double processing. It is highly probable that this development made use of the strong lateralization of the human brain. I do not want to suggest that lateralization caused human culture, but what I do suspect is that a lateralization, which was already present (and which is related in primates to handedness*), allowed for the double processing, in terms of stable and changing patterns, of visual and acoustic information in animals with full stereoscopic vision, resulting in a 100% identity of the visual input in the two hemispheres. The coordinating process required a substantial enlargement of the equally present ‘comparator’ or ‘cockpit’, according to the term coined by Elkhonon Goldberg. (p123)


The double processing of the stream of incoming information results in a combination of two types of patterns: stable structures, on the one hand (which we can now identify as ‘schemata’, ‘scripts’, ‘concepts’, ‘structures’, or ‘signs’) and a changing situation, on the other hand (identified as ‘reality’, ‘substance’, ‘object’, ‘the thing itself’, etc.). Memories can now be stored and worked upon independently of the actual situation. Evidently, the most could be made of this development if the set of available memories were considerable. Both factors (a large set of memories and a strong comparator) required brain space. This could be that ‘compelling reason’ why the human brain got so large between 2 and 1.5 million years ago and why the costs of such a large brain were worth paying. (p124)

The stable pattern (memory) is related to a changing pattern (an occurrence). It is this activity of relating that turns the stable patterns into signs, which are used to recognize (to give form to, to interpret, to signify) that other more floating set of patterns constituting actuality. The here and now of the situation, in turn, is what is not a sign. It is ‘reality’, ‘the world’, ‘the object’. Although we immediately admit that this too is a construction based on memories. But the difference between the two is not a construction of our memory, and that is crucial. Thus cognition becomes intentional or semiotic. (p124-5)

The first step in the evolution of culture, as we have seen, must have been that of the doubling of the information processing system: basically the doubling of the representation of perception. (p126)

Semiotic mimetic actions are fundamentally different from imitations, as imitation involves the copying of behaviour, whereas mimesis comes with a new way of representing behaviour, namely without actually performing it (cf. Donald 1991, 2006). Through mimesis, the stable memories, or signs, are acted out and become audible and visible.*

*This corresponds to Piaget’s (1962) notion of “representative imitation”, which according to him emerges out of sensory-motor imitation, via deferred imitation (cf. Zlatev 2007).

Human culture is the process in which more or less stable memories are used to deal with the difference that the world forces upon us. (p127)

Our identity as human beings is thus a process in which we continuously invest energy. […] We exist as a set of memories and as a process in which these memories are used to deal with a dynamic environment. I am, we are, ‘in the making’. Viewing the self as a process rather than as an object therefore becomes more natural (Noble 2006). (p128)

Self-consciousness, both individual and collective, is thus a form of recursion; not formal, but semiotic recursion. Whereas in formal recursion a form consists of elements that reproduce that same form (as in a triangle consisting of three smaller triangles, each of which again consists of three smaller triangles, etc.), in semiotic recursion the process of representation (of ‘aboutness’) is about that process itself. This is what we call reflexivity, meta-representation or meta-cognition. The self is always a constructed self as well as a remembered self or, rather, a self ‘under construction’. (p128-9)

Moreover, the process as such is again remembered, which gives us a strong feeling of being, and having been, alive (cf. Metzinger 2003). […] Art and philosophy are two important forms of meta-cognition in modern and in contemporary culture. Whereas art reflects our life in concrete images, sounds, and stories, philosophy does so through abstract conceptualizations. (p129)

The ‘double processing’ hypothesis presented in this paper would allow us to shed light on the evolution of human culture and on cultural evolution as well. Semiotic cognition became possible because of a change in the primate information processing system. Once this system was in place, a new logic of development could emerge. The logic of cultural evolution seems to be based on what is, in the end, a very simple criterion, namely: whether a sign or sign system offers better chances of dealing with the difference arising in a specific personal, social and natural context, and in so doing also offers better chances of prediction and survival. Which brings us back to biology. This search for better solutions to the problem of difference can explain individual, social, and geographical variations in culture, as well as the steady increase of both abstraction and cultural complexity. (p129-30)

Even though culture certainly is a fact of human biology, what makes it so interesting is the fact that out of biology, in this case, emerges a form of cognition that became free, at least to a certain extent, of the laws of biology by adding a new dimension to these laws, namely the dimension of the semiotic. (p130)

The approach is deeply and truly Darwinian, in the sense that it applies Darwin’s perspective where it can and should be applied, and uses it to explain how and why a non-Darwinian evolutionary system, though nested in biological evolution and fulfilling the same goals, could emerge. Neo- Darwinism is fruitful, but only up to a certain point – which is that of the semiotic. Beyond that point, the laws of development change: instead of ‘BVSR = Blind Variation + Selective Retention’, the logic of the semiotic process, involving mimesis, imagination, conceptualization, and analysis will determine the course of human evolution.* Whereas selective retention may continue to function as it did in animal life, cultural variation is not blind, but informed by semiosis and driven by semiotic strategies.**

[For the Primitive Mind] “What is seen in dreams is, theoretically, true. To minds which have but slight perception of the law of contradiction, and which the presence of the same thing in various places at one and the same time does not perturb in the least, what reason is there for doubting these data more than any others. …Since nothing seems more natural to him than the communication between the seen and the unseen worlds, why should he mistrust what he sees in dreams any more than what he sees with his eyes wide open?” (And these things are even more valuable to him because of their mystic origin.) (p101)

It may happen that what the primitive sees in dreams are circumstances which are to occur later; these circumstances are both prospective, because he foresees their happening, and they are also retrospective, because he has seen them take place. Such a thing is an impossibility to minds governed, as ours are, by the law of contradiction, for they have a clear representation of time unfolding in a unilinear series of successive moments. How can the same event occupy two different places in this series, at a distance from each other, and thus belong to the past and the future? Such an impossibility, however, puts no strain upon the prelogical mentality…. …Their simultaneity of data, as well as their ‘multi-presence of a person’ cannot coexist in time and space with us… (p105)

Regarding a native’s dream about the theft of some of his pumpkins by a white man, and even though the white man had never even been to this native man’s property, the native says, “If you had been there, you would have taken them”. And so the character of the white man in the dream was actually the will of that person. It doesn’t matter what you do… (p106-107)

Julian Jaynes Bicameral Breakdown: The Code of Hammurabi

Julian Jaynes Bicameral Breakdown Series, 5 of 8

The prologue/epilogue is written by Hammurabi, the text is about him and his relationship to his god, evident is the concept of ‘I’ or ‘self’.

The code itself is written by Marduk, his god, spoken to Hammurabi and channeled from him to a scribe.

Both sides are unconscious of each other. When the code is written, Hammurabi, in a trance, lets the unconscious take over.

Julian Jaynes Bicameral Breakdown: Writing and the Erosion of the Bicameral Mind

Julian Jaynes Bicameral Breakdown Series, 3 of 8

Writing eroded the auditory authority of the bicameral mind [god’s orders were transmitted via ‘auditory hallucinations’ within mind of the bicameral man]. The input to the divine hallucinatory aspect of the bicameral mind was auditory. Once the word of god was silent, written on dumb clay tablets or incised into speechless stone, the god’s commands or the king’s directives could be turned to or avoided by one’s own efforts in a way that auditory hallucinations never could be. The word of god had a controllable location rather than an ubiquitous power with immediate obedience (p208).

“What had to be spoken is now silent and carved upon a stone to be taken in visually” (p302).

Julian Jaynes Bicameral Breakdown: The Disappearance of God

Julian Jaynes Bicameral Breakdown Series, 2 of 8

As the complexity of society increases, the bicameral mind becomes stressed, requiring elaborate rituals to maintain the voice within.

[end of 3rd millennium B.C.] the tempo and complexity of social organization demand a far greater number of decisions in a far greater number of contexts, resulting in a proliferation of deities for any potential situation (p196).

As gods increased in complexity (in the Near East, 2nd millennium B.C.) unsureness creates personal gods to intercede and reach the higher gods – “Who seem to be receding into the heavens where in one brief millennium they will have disappeared” (p202).

Inconsistency between people:

As people migrate, quickly due to major geological/climatological stressors, as refugees, they are thrust into ever-increasing new situations not dealt with before, either by themselves or their ancestors. The voices then say different things to different people. Hierarchical authority deconstructs and loses its validity.

Julian Jaynes Bicameral Breakdown: General Notes

Julian Jaynes Bicameral Breakdown Series, 1 of 8

[The Iliad] There is no evidence of consciousness; instead, the gods take place of consciousness. Man doesn’t know he is conscious; he is not aware; his feelings and decisions come from god (p72).

[The Bible] Amos does not consciously think before he speaks, in fact, he does not think as we do at all; his thinking is done for him (p296).

The function of the gods was chiefly the guiding and planning of action in novel situations. The gods size up problems and organize action according to an ongoing pattern or purpose resulting in intricate bicameral civilizations, fitting all the disparate part together, planting times, harvest times, the sorting out of commodities, all the vast putting together of things in a grand design, and the giving of directions to the neurological man in his verbal and analytical sanctuary in the left hemisphere. We might thus predict that one residual function of the right hemisphere today would be an organizational one (p117-118)

Individuals do not respond to even basic physiological needs except within the whole pattern of the group’s activity. A thirsty baboon, for example, does not leave the group and go seeking water; it is the whole group that moves, or none. Thirst is satiated only within the patterned activity of the group (p127).

The gods were in no sense a ‘figment of the imagination’ of anyone. They were man’s volition. They occupied his nervous system and transmitted experience into articulated speech which then ‘told’ the man what to do (p202).


Bicameral Timeline

2000-1000 BC: man stops hearing voices

1000-0 BC: oracle and prophets die away

0-1000 AD: sayings and hearings preserved in sacred text

1000-2000 AD: sacred text loses its authority


Literary examples of Bicameralism Theory (vs. Subjective Consciousness)

Chinese-Confucious (SC)

India-Veda (bicam) / Upanishads (SC)

Hebrew-Bible: Amos (bicam) / Ecclesiastes (SC)

Greek-The Iliad (bicam) / The Odyssey (SC)


By 400 B.C. bicameral prophecy is dead (p312)
